Utilize a modelagem lógica
mostrada abaixo para responder
Qual dos comandos abaixo faz a
inserção de um novo funcionário
chamado "Fulano", com salário
de dez mil e trabalha no
departamento de "dados"?
a-INSERT INTO tb_funcionarios (id_funcionario, nome,
departamento, salario) VALUES (3, Fulano, Dados; 10000);
b- INSERT INTO tb_funcionarios (id_funcionario, nome, salario,
departamento) VALUES (3, Fulano, Dados; 10000);
c- INSERT INTO tb_funcionarios (id_funcionario, nome,
departamento, salario) VALUES (3, Fulano; 'Dados, 10);
d-INSERT INTO tb_funcionarios (nome, departamento, salario)
VALUES (Fulano, 'Dados, 10000);
e-INSERT INTO tb_funcionarios (id, nome, departamento, salario)
VALUES (3, Fulano, Dados; 10000);
Respostas
respondido por:
4
Resposta:
INSERT INTO tb_funcionarios (id_funcionario, nome, departamento, salario) VALUES (3, ‘Fulano’, ‘Dados’, 10000);
Explicação:
Para a resolução devemos ler o nome das colunas em nossa tabela e comparar com o nome das colunas nas alternativas.
respondido por:
0
Resposta: LETRA A : INSERT INTO tb_funcionarios (id_funcionario, nome,
departamento, salario) VALUES (3, Fulano, Dados; 10000);
Explicação: É preciso prestar muita atenção para responder essa questão pois a resposta está nos detalhes da ordem de aparecimento das colunas e seus respetivos nomes no INSERT em relação aos valores. O INSERT correto neste caso, então, é o INSERT INTO tb_funcionarios (id_funcionario, nome, departamento, salario) VALUES (3, ‘Fulano’, ‘Dados’, 10000);
Prof. Ana Beatriz
Perguntas similares
3 anos atrás
3 anos atrás
3 anos atrás
5 anos atrás
5 anos atrás
7 anos atrás
7 anos atrás